📜 While specific biblical narratives about dreaming of being *inside* a tower are not a common direct theme, the concept of towers in ancient texts often represents human ambition, separation, or places of refuge. The Tower of Babel, for instance, speaks to the dangers of hubris and division. In a broader sense, being enclosed within such a structure in a dream can echo the ancient human experience of seeking safety in fortifications or the spiritual isolation that can come from striving for a higher, perhaps unattainable, perspective. It speaks to universal themes of boundaries, ambition, and the human desire for security or separation from the mundane.
